Church's Texas Chicken remains a popular spot for a satisfying meal. The restaurant serves good food, with customers enjoying their chicken and okra. However, some have noted that the chicken parts have gotten smaller over the years. Despite some service inconsistencies, customers continue to return for the tasty food, with workers ensuring that customers have everything they need, including extra sauces and honey. The restaurant can get busy, with local traffic and occasional loitering from the homeless population, but the service is often described as overly friendly. While the food may not always be "fresh," it is generally "acceptable," and the restaurant offers a convenient and affordable dining option for the local community.
